1. Jet Set Radio

Jet Set Radio is a skateboarding game with a very unique and innovative art style. The game is set in a futuristic Tokyo and you take the role of a member of a gang known as the GGs. The game plays a lot like Crazy Taxi in the sense that you are moving around the city completing objectives and avoiding the authorities. The main difference between the two games is that in Jet Set Radio you are skateboarding while in Crazy Taxi you are driving.

3. Grand Theft Auto V

Grand Theft Auto V is an open world action-adventure game developed by Rockstar Games. You take the role of three different characters, Michael, Trevor and Franklin, who are all trying to make their way in the criminal underworld of Los Santos. The gameplay is similar to that of Crazy Taxi in that you are driving around an open world completing objectives and evading the police. The main difference between the two games is that in Grand Theft Auto V you have much more of an action-oriented experience, with the ability to engage in gunfights and fist-fights.
